Excel列宽批量设置怎么做?如何快速调整?
作者:佚名|分类:EXCEL|浏览:82|发布时间:2025-04-07 19:51:14
Excel列宽批量设置怎么做?如何快速调整?
在Excel中,合理地设置列宽可以让我们更清晰地查看表格内容,提高工作效率。然而,手动调整每一列的宽度既耗时又费力。那么,如何批量设置Excel列宽,实现快速调整呢?以下将详细介绍几种方法。
一、使用“列宽”功能
1. 打开Excel表格,选中需要调整列宽的列。
2. 在“开始”选项卡中,找到“格式”组,点击“列宽”按钮。
3. 在弹出的对话框中,输入所需的列宽值,点击“确定”即可。
二、使用鼠标拖动列标题
1. 将鼠标移至列标题的边缘,当鼠标变成双向箭头时,按住鼠标左键。
2. 拖动鼠标,直到达到所需的列宽。
3. 释放鼠标左键,即可完成列宽的调整。
三、使用快捷键
1. 选中需要调整列宽的列。
2. 按下“Ctrl+Shift+>”组合键,可以快速将选中的列设置为最宽的列宽。
3. 按下“Ctrl+Shift+<”组合键,可以快速将选中的列设置为最窄的列宽。
四、使用“自动调整列宽”功能
1. 选中需要调整列宽的列。
2. 在“开始”选项卡中,找到“格式”组,点击“自动调整列宽”按钮。
3. 在弹出的对话框中,选择“根据内容自动调整列宽”或“根据窗口自动调整列宽”,点击“确定”即可。
五、使用VBA脚本
1. 打开Excel,按下“Alt+F11”键,进入VBA编辑器。
2. 在“插入”菜单中选择“模块”,在打开的模块窗口中粘贴以下代码:
```vba
Sub SetColumnWidth()
Dim ws As Worksheet
Set ws = ActiveSheet
Dim col As Range
For Each col In ws.UsedRange.Columns
col.AutoFit
Next col
End Sub
```
3. 关闭VBA编辑器,回到Excel界面。
4. 按下“Alt+F8”键,选择“SetColumnWidth”宏,点击“运行”即可批量设置列宽。
六、使用“列宽”功能(针对多列)
1. 选中需要调整列宽的多列。
2. 在“开始”选项卡中,找到“格式”组,点击“列宽”按钮。
3. 在弹出的对话框中,输入所需的列宽值,点击“确定”即可。
总结:
以上介绍了多种批量设置Excel列宽的方法,可以根据实际需求选择合适的方法。在实际操作中,我们可以根据表格的实际情况,灵活运用这些方法,提高工作效率。
相关问答:
1. 问:如何快速调整多列的列宽?
答: 可以使用“列宽”功能,选中需要调整的多列,然后在“列宽”对话框中输入所需的列宽值。
2. 问:如何将所有列宽设置为相同值?
答: 可以使用“自动调整列宽”功能,选中所有列,然后点击“自动调整列宽”按钮,选择“根据内容自动调整列宽”或“根据窗口自动调整列宽”。
3. 问:如何使用VBA脚本批量设置列宽?
答: 在VBA编辑器中插入模块,粘贴以下代码:
```vba
Sub SetColumnWidth()
Dim ws As Worksheet
Set ws = ActiveSheet
Dim col As Range
For Each col In ws.UsedRange.Columns
col.AutoFit
Next col
End Sub
```
然后运行该宏即可。
4. 问:如何调整列宽,使表格内容显示更清晰?
答: 可以根据表格内容的长短,适当调整列宽。如果内容较长,可以适当增加列宽;如果内容较短,可以适当减小列宽。同时,可以使用“自动调整列宽”功能,让Excel自动调整列宽。